crypto: drbg - Clean up generation code

A few miscellaneous cleanups to make the code a bit more readable:

  - Replace (buf, buflen) with (out, outlen)
  - Update (out, outlen) as we go along
  - Use size_t for lengths
  - Use min()
  - Adjust some comments and log messages
  - Rename a variable named 'len' to 'err', since it isn't a length
